The Alabama A&M Bulldogs and the North Alabama Lions will meet on Monday evening in a non‑conference matchup at the Alabama A&M Events Center in Huntsville, Alabama.

Alabama A&M Bulldogs Betting Preview

The Alabama A&M Bulldogs enter Monday night’s contest with a 5–4 overall win-loss record, including a perfect 4–0 mark at home. The Bulldogs have compiled wins over Blue Mountain, Charleston Southern, Lindenwood, Tennessee State, and Arkansas Baptist, while dropping games to Indiana, Clemson, Coastal Carolina, and Lipscomb. In Alabama A&M’s 80–53 win over Tennessee State earlier this month, guard Sami Pissis tallied 21 points (7 of 12 shooting from the field), 7 assists, 1 rebound and 2 steals showcasing his ability to lead the offense.

The Alabama A&M Bulldogs average 63.9 points per game on 39 percent shooting from the field and 33.6 percent shooting from three‑point range. Defensively, the Bulldogs are allowing opponents 75.9 points per game.

Senior guard Sami Pissis leads the Alabama A&M Bulldogs averaging 12 points, 3 rebounds, 3.4 assists and 1 steal a game. Senior guard Kintavious Dozier contributes 12.8 points, 3.8 rebounds, 1.8 assists and 1.6 steals per contest. Senior forward PJ Eason provides the Aggies with a strong interior presence averaging 7.4 points, 6.9 rebounds and 1.6 blocks a game.   

North Alabama Lions Betting Preview

The Southeastern Louisiana Lions enter Monday’s contest with a 4–6 record, including a 1–1 mark in Southland Conference play. The Lions have compiled wins over Northwestern State, Jacksonville State the San Francisco Dons, while losing games to Mississippi State, Clemson and the East Tennessee State Buccaneers. In the North Alabama Lions 73–66 win over Jacksonville State last month, forward Donte Bacchus accumulated 19 points, 9 rebounds, 1 assist and 1 block illustrating his ability to impact the game on both ends of the floor.

The North Alabama Lions average 68.4 points on 41 percent shooting from the field and 31.5 percent shooting from three‑point range per game. On the defensive side of the basketball, the Lions are allowing opponents 75.4 points per game.

Senior forward Donte Bacchus leads the North Alabama Lions averaging 14.1 points, 6 rebounds, 1.6 assists and 1.2 steals per game, while shooting 49.5 percent from the field. Junior forward Corneilous Williams adds 13.6 points, 10.4 rebounds and 1.2 blocks per contest, providing the Lions with a presence in the paint. Junior guard Canin Jefferson averages 10.9 points, 1.8 rebounds and 2.1 assists per game.
